
Go Programming Essentials
This includes the opportunity to earn a GoLang certification from Alta3 Research.
Master the features of the Go Programming Language! Learn how to program using this open-source programming language, developed and supported by Google!. Hands-on Labs and environment reinforce skills.
Go is designed to be concise, clean, and efficient. It is easy to write programs that get the most out of multicore and networked machines. Go compiles quickly to machine code yet has the feel of a dynamically typed, interpreted language.
Be it system admins, network, cloud, or storage engineers, all lessons in our courseware are highly relevant for using Go to craft enterprise solutions.
Overview
Go is designed to be concise, clean, and efficient. It is easy to write programs that get the most out of multicore and networked machines, while its novel type system enables flexible and modular program construction. Go compiles quickly to machine code yet has the feel of a dynamically typed, interpreted language.
Be it system admins, network, cloud, or storage engineers, all lessons in our courseware are highly relevant for using Go to craft enterprise solutions.
Class is a combination of live instructor demo and hands-on labs.
What You’ll Learn
- Current Go Standard Library
- Relevant networking libraries
- Version control with git
- Git integration with popular SCM (GitHub)
- Executing system commands
- Parsing and building files
- Consuming RESTful APIs with Go
- Creating a RESTful API with Go
- Parsing JSON
- Parsing XML files
- Building a simple web app with Go
- Containerizing Go Apps with Docker
- Interaction with databases
- Project structure best practice techniques
Certification:
Alta3 Research Go 101 - Cerধficaধon Project
Prerequisites:
Recommended to have some experience in another language, although, not required
Who Should Attend:
- Software Developers
- System Administrators
- Network Engineers
- DevOps Operators
Follow-on Courses:
- Python 201 - Python for API and API Design (5 days)
- Git and GitHub (or Git and GitLab) (2 days)
Outline
Full Refund Guarantee
Request more
information
About the Instructor
You have already taken demo for this course.
If you want to get access to demo again, feel free to contact our support at (855) 800-8240
This includes the opportunity to earn a GoLang certification from Alta3 Research.
Master the features of the Go Programming Language! Learn how to program using this open-source programming language, developed and supported by Google!. Hands-on Labs and environment reinforce skills.
Go is designed to be concise, clean, and efficient. It is easy to write programs that get the most out of multicore and networked machines. Go compiles quickly to machine code yet has the feel of a dynamically typed, interpreted language.
Be it system admins, network, cloud, or storage engineers, all lessons in our courseware are highly relevant for using Go to craft enterprise solutions.
Public Schedule
Reviews
Why Cloud Institute

Flexible Training
We help teams become project-ready by tailoring training and instruction to align to your business goals and requirements.
Hands-On Practice
Shorten the learning curve. Validate your skills in Challenge Labs featuring real scenarios in risk-free environments.
Personalized Coaching
We make sure classroom training transfers to the workplace with post-training coaching from cloud practitioners.
Money-Back Guarantee
Your training is our top priority. If you're not satisfied with the course, request a full refund up to 10 days after purchase.